
Rattlesnakes are one of the most feared hazards in hiking — and one of the most misunderstood. Most hikers either panic at the thought of encountering one or carry completely wrong information about what to do if a bite actually happens. Both responses create problems. The panic is statistically disproportionate to the actual risk, and the wrong first aid response can turn a manageable medical situation into a life-threatening one.
According to data from the USDA, approximately 8,000 people are bitten by rattlesnakes annually in the United States. Between 10 and 15 of those bites result in death — roughly one in 600. To put that in perspective, the odds of being bitten at all are approximately one in 38,000, and the odds of dying in a car accident are one in 112. The drive to the trailhead is statistically more dangerous than the rattlesnake waiting at the other end of it.
None of that means rattlesnake bites are trivial — they require prompt medical attention and the right immediate response. But they are survivable, the animal is not aggressive toward humans, and the right knowledge eliminates most of the danger that misinformation creates.

Understanding Rattlesnake Behavior — The Foundation of Prevention
The single most useful thing to understand about rattlesnakes is that they have no interest in you. A rattlesnake on the trail is not predatory toward humans — you are not prey and you are not a threat it wants to engage. What it wants is to be left alone. The rattle exists specifically to warn you away before a defensive strike becomes necessary. A rattlesnake that rattles at you is communicating, not attacking.
The vast majority of rattlesnake bites happen in two scenarios: someone accidentally steps on or near a snake they didn’t see, or someone intentionally handles or disturbs a snake. The first is a matter of trail awareness. The second is entirely avoidable by simply not touching snakes.
Western Pacific rattlesnakes — the most common species encountered on California trails — are particularly abundant in woodland areas, on rocky terrain, and in brushy chaparral. They’re most active in spring and fall when temperatures are moderate. Spring is when young are born, and fall from roughly September through October is when juveniles are most active and most frequently encountered. During summer, peak heat activity pushes snakes into shade and makes midday encounters less likely than morning and evening.
How to Avoid Rattlesnakes on the Trail
Watch where you step. The most fundamental prevention — looking at the ground in front of you, particularly on rocky trails, around fallen logs, and at the edges of brush where snakes rest in shade. The hiker focused on the view or the conversation while walking through prime snake habitat is the hiker most likely to step on one.
Use your trekking poles. Tap rocks, logs, and dense brush areas before stepping over or around them. The vibration often prompts a snake to rattle or move before you’re close enough to step on it. This is particularly useful when navigating around large boulders where the far side is invisible before you’re already beside it.
The person at the front of the group carries more responsibility. On group hikes, the lead hiker sets the pace and is most likely to encounter snakes first. Move deliberately through brushy sections, scan the trail ahead, and alert the group when a snake is present rather than rushing past it.
Give encountered snakes distance and time. A rattlesnake on the trail that you see before reaching it is not a crisis — it’s simply an animal in your path that needs time to move. Stop the group, give the snake 10 feet of clearance minimum, and wait. Do not throw rocks, sticks, or hiking poles at it. Do not attempt to move it with a stick. Give it time to move on its own, then pass well around it while watching both the snake and the area immediately around your detour path.
Watch where you sit. A rest stop on a sunny rock in snake country warrants the same caution as walking through it. Tap the area around your planned seating position before sitting down. This feels overly cautious until the one time it reveals a coiled snake in your rest spot.
Pay attention to the rattle. If you hear a rattle, freeze, locate the source by sound and then movement before moving, and back away slowly. The rattle is not an indication that a snake is about to strike — it’s the opposite. It’s a warning designed to prevent the encounter from escalating. Respect it accordingly.
What NOT to Do If You’re Bitten
This section matters more than the what-to-do section, because several widely circulated first aid responses to rattlesnake bites actively worsen the outcome. These myths are persistent enough that people apply them with genuine belief they’re helping — and in doing so, they create additional medical complications alongside the bite itself.
Do not cut the wound. The idea that cutting around the bite and bleeding it out releases venom is a myth with no medical support. Cutting the wound causes additional tissue damage, increases infection risk, and can push venom deeper into surrounding tissue rather than out of it. It does not remove venom.
Do not apply a tourniquet. This is one of the most dangerous responses to a rattlesnake bite. A tourniquet applied above a bite on a limb concentrates the venom in the tissue below the tourniquet without meaningfully slowing systemic absorption. The concentrated venom causes dramatically more localized tissue damage — in severe cases, enough to require amputation of the limb. Do not apply a tourniquet for any rattlesnake bite.
Do not use a snakebite suction kit. These kits — sold at many outdoor retailers — contain a suction device designed to extract venom from the bite wound. Multiple studies have demonstrated that they do not work. They extract negligible amounts of venom while potentially closing the wound opening, which can actually reduce the natural bleeding that helps flush venom from the immediate bite site. Leave the suction kit in the kit.
Do not take ibuprofen, aspirin, or blood-thinning pain relievers. These medications interact adversely with snake venom and can amplify the venom’s effects on blood clotting and tissue damage. If pain relief is necessary, acetaminophen (Tylenol) is the safer option — but getting to medical care quickly is the priority over managing pain.
Do not try to suck the venom out with your mouth. This introduces bacteria from the mouth into the wound, creating infection risk without removing meaningful amounts of venom.
Do not attempt to catch or kill the snake. This is how secondary bites happen, and it’s how people who had a manageable situation turn it into a worse one. You don’t need the snake for treatment — hospitals use polyvalent antivenom that works across multiple species. Get away from the snake and focus entirely on getting to medical care.
Do not panic and run. Elevated heart rate accelerates venom absorption. Move deliberately and calmly.
What TO Do If You’re Bitten
Stay calm. This is easier said than done, but it’s medically significant. Elevated heart rate from panic increases the rate of venom circulation through the bloodstream. Take a breath, assess the situation, and move through the following steps deliberately rather than frantically.
Circle the bite and note the time. Mark the area of the bite on your skin with a pen if available, and write down the exact time the bite occurred. Emergency responders will use this information to determine the appropriate antivenom dosage and monitor the progression of symptoms. If you’re already symptomatic when you reach the hospital, this information matters more because your ability to communicate reliably may be impaired.
Let the wound bleed freely. Do not bandage, cover, or apply pressure to the bite wound. Allowing the wound to bleed naturally may help clear some venom from the immediate bite area. Rinse the wound lightly with clean water if available, then leave it alone.
Remove rings, watches, and jewelry from the affected limb. The bite area will swell — sometimes dramatically. A ring or watch band on a swelling limb can become impossible to remove and can restrict circulation severely enough to threaten the limb. Remove all jewelry from the bitten limb immediately before swelling begins.
Immobilize the affected limb at or below heart level. Keep the bitten limb as still as possible and position it at or slightly below heart level. Elevation of the limb increases the rate of venom absorption; keeping it low slows it slightly without the risks of a tourniquet.
Get to a hospital as quickly as possible. Antivenom is the only effective treatment for rattlesnake envenomation. It requires refrigeration and medical administration — it’s not something you can carry in a first aid kit or purchase over the counter. The singular goal after a bite is reaching a facility that has antivenom as quickly as possible.
If you have cell service, call 911 immediately. Tell the dispatcher you’ve been bitten by a rattlesnake, give your location including the trailhead name, and ask them to direct you to the nearest hospital with antivenom on hand. If you’re close to the trailhead and capable of driving, having a companion drive you is faster than waiting for emergency services in remote areas.
What to Do If You’re Deep in the Backcountry
Five or ten miles from the trailhead with no cell service changes the calculation but not the fundamental response: get to antivenom as quickly as possible.
Press the SOS button on your satellite communicator. If you carry a Garmin inReach, SPOT, or similar satellite communicator — and every solo backcountry hiker should — activate the SOS function immediately. International emergency coordination centers can dispatch helicopter rescue to your GPS coordinates. A helicopter can reach a remote location and evacuate a snake bite patient to a hospital with antivenom in a fraction of the time it would take to hike out. If you have no satellite communicator, start moving toward the trailhead. Yes, hiking with a rattlesnake bite feels counterintuitive. But the only thing between you and antivenom is the distance to your car and then to a hospital. Move deliberately — not running, not panicking — toward the exit. Take a minimal pack with water. Keep the bitten limb as still as possible while moving. You likely have several hours before systemic symptoms become severely debilitating.
Have the person who is least affected lead the way out. If you’re hiking with a group and the bite victim is compromised, assign the strongest remaining hiker to navigate the fastest route out while others assist the patient. One person should have the satellite communicator. One person should have the first aid kit. The rest focus on moving the patient as calmly and quickly as possible.
Know your route before you need it. Download offline maps for any backcountry area before you lose cell service. Knowing where you are and where the trailhead is requires either memory, a paper map, or an offline digital map — cell service is not a reliable navigation backup in remote areas.
Identifying Rattlesnakes vs. Lookalike Species
Gopher snakes are the most common rattlesnake lookalike encountered on California trails. They have an affinity for defensive mimicry — when threatened, they flatten and widen their heads into a triangular shape, coil defensively, and vibrate their tails against dry leaves to mimic the rattlesnake’s rattle. This mimicry is effective enough that hikers frequently mistake them for rattlesnakes.
The key identifiers for actual rattlesnakes are the segmented rattle at the tail tip, the distinctive triangular head that’s noticeably wider than the neck, and the heat-sensing pit between the eye and nostril. Gopher snakes have a smoother, shinier appearance with a rounder head and a solid tapered tail without rattles.
The practical advice: treat any snake you’re uncertain about as a rattlesnake. The cost of being wrong about a gopher snake — unnecessary caution and distance — is far lower than being wrong about a rattlesnake. Don’t handle any snake in the field regardless of your identification confidence.
Gear Worth Carrying in Rattlesnake Country
Satellite communicator: The single most important safety device for backcountry hiking in rattlesnake habitat. The Garmin inReach Mini provides two-way satellite texting and SOS capability anywhere in the world. Cell phones do not provide this capability in areas without cell coverage.
Trekking poles: Trail navigation tools that double as snake detection tools. Tapping rocks and brush before stepping around them is the most practical rattlesnake avoidance behavior available.
Gaiters: Low trail gaiters covering the ankle reduce the exposed skin area at the most common bite height. They don’t make you immune to a bite but they reduce the surface area at the most vulnerable location — the ankle and lower leg where most trail bites occur. Snake gaiters: For hiking specifically in high-density rattlesnake environments — desert trails in Arizona, Texas, and the Mojave — dedicated snake gaiters provide ballistic material coverage from ankle to knee specifically designed to prevent fang penetration. Different from standard trail gaiters and worth considering for targeted use in peak rattlesnake habitat.
First aid kit: A comprehensive trail first aid kit covers the wound marking and management steps described above. It does not contain antivenom and should not create a false sense that you can treat a rattlesnake bite in the field beyond the stabilization steps above. Final Thoughts
Rattlesnakes are not the hiking hazard most people believe them to be. The odds of being bitten are low, the odds of dying from a bite with appropriate response are lower, and the animal itself is not interested in engaging you. What creates danger is the combination of inattention on the trail and the wrong first aid response when a bite does occur.
Watch where you step. Give encountered snakes distance and time. Carry a satellite communicator for remote backcountry hiking. And if a bite happens — stay calm, note the time, let it bleed, remove jewelry, and get to a hospital without cutting, sucking, applying tourniquets, or doing anything else the myths of snake bite first aid suggest.
The snake is not trying to kill you. The myths about what to do after it bites you carry more statistical risk than the bite itself.
